架构专题
项目实战
面试突击
技术文章
关于
{{userData.name}}
已认证
文章
评论
关注
粉丝
¥
{{role.user_data.money}}
{{role.user_data.credit}}
您已完成今天任务的
财富管理
余额、积分管理
推广中心
推广有奖励
NEW
任务中心
每日任务
NEW
成为会员
购买付费会员
我的订单
查看我的订单
我的设置
编辑个人资料
进入后台管理
登录
快速注册
全部标签
ReentrantReadWriteLock
ReentrantReadWriteLock的实现原理与锁获取详解
我们继续Java多线程与并发系列之旅,之前我们分享了Synchronized 和 ReentrantLock 都是独占锁,即在同一时刻只有一个线程获取到锁。 然而在有些业务场景中,我们大多在读取数据,很少写入数据,这种情况下,如果仍使用独占锁,效率将及其低下。 针对这种情况,Java提供了读写锁——ReentrantReadWriteLock。 有点类似MySQL数据库为代表的读写分离机制,既然我…
Java多线程
3.2k
0
发布文章
发布快讯
创建圈子
发表话题
发布供求信息
发布问答
发布网址导航
提交工单